Bishopstone (Sussex) station may not feature the grandiosity of some major stations, yet it offers essential services to ensure a smooth start to your journey. While there is no ticket office, ticket machines are available for you to easily collect tickets purchased online. These machines are designed to be accessible, supporting discounts for Disabled Persons Railcard holders.
Access support is well-founded, even if the station itself has limitations. With no step-free access, careful planning is recommended. The station provides an "Assistance Meeting Point" and offers staff-operated ramps for train access. It's worth booking help in advance, although you can press the "emergency & assisted travel" button on platform Help Points for immediate support.

Balcombe train station offers a range of facilities to make your travel experience comfortable and convenient. The ticket office is open from 6:30 AM to 2:30 PM Monday through Saturday. For those in need of purchasing or collecting tickets at other times, worry not, as the station boasts accessible ticket machines that offer transport with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. If you’ve bought your tickets online, simply collect them at a designated machine.
The station is partially accessible, with step-free access available to platform 1 for trains heading to London. For those travelling towards Brighton, a footbridge access is required. Although Balcombe lacks certain amenities like waiting rooms and accessible toilets, it does have a comfortable seating area for travelers to relax while waiting for their trains. Additionally, CCTV at the station ensures added safety, while customer help points on the platforms provide assistance at any time of the day.
Upon arriving at Balcombe, travelers can easily transition to other modes of transport, ensuring a seamless journey. The station provides detailed onward travel information, including local bus services which can be referenced online. Although the station doesn’t host extensive car services, there is ample parking space operated by APCOA Parking UK, available 24/7. However, it's worth noting that while there are two accessible spaces, accessible equipment is not present.
